Edward Smith Stinson, a resident of Medford for over 52 years, passed away at a local hospital Thursday. Mr Stinson was born near Centerville, IA, August 6, 1865. He was united in marriage to Rose Ella Daily, December 25, 1884. She preceded him in death June 16, 1929.
Mr Stinson had been affiliated with the First Baptist Church since 1905 and served as a deacon for many years. He leaves to mourn his loss, three children, Frank O and William H Stinson, of Medford, and Mrs Stanley Taylor of McMinnville, OR; also 13 grandchildren and 5 great grandchildren. Funeral services will be conducted from Perl Funeral Home Saturday at 2 pm, the Rev WA Dawes, pastor of the First Baptist Church officiating. Interment will take place in Medford IOOF Cemetery.
